Market Overview

The Compositing Equipment market is a critical segment of the broader visual effects industry, which plays a significant role in film and television production, video games, and advertising. Compositing equipment refers to the hardware and software tools used to combine multiple visual elements, such as computer-generated imagery (CGI), live-action footage, and special effects, to create a seamless and visually compelling final product. This process allows filmmakers and content creators to transport audiences to imaginative and breathtaking worlds.

Meaning

Compositing is a fundamental aspect of post-production in the entertainment industry. It involves layering and blending different visual elements, integrating them seamlessly to create realistic and captivating scenes. This process enhances the overall quality of the content, allowing for the integration of impossible scenarios and extraordinary visual effects.

Segmentation

The Compositing Equipment market can be segmented based on the type of equipment (software, hardware) and end-users (film production, television production, advertising, gaming, etc.). Software compositing solutions are prevalent due to their flexibility and wide-ranging functionalities, while hardware solutions cater to studios with specific requirements and budget considerations.

Category-wise Insights

  1. Software Solutions:
    • Compositing software solutions offer an extensive range of features, including green screen keying, motion tracking, and visual effects integration. They are preferred by many studios for their versatility and real-time capabilities.
  2. Hardware Solutions:
    • Hardware solutions encompass specialized workstations, graphics cards, and render farms. Studios with high processing demands and a need for faster rendering times often invest in dedicated hardware solutions.
